Czym jest przetwarzanie w chmurze?
Koncepcje chmury obliczeniowej
Czym jest przetwarzanie w chmurze?
Cloud computing jest definiowane jako korzystanie z udostępnionych zasobów obliczeniowych, takich jak serwery, pamięć masowa i bazy danych, sieci, aplikacje, analityka, a nawet inteligencja, do których uzyskuje się dostęp przez Internet jako usługę. Jest to model, w którym zamiast posiadania i zarządzania własnymi centrami danych i serwerami, firma korzysta z technologii i usług dostawcy usług w chmurze, gdy jest to wymagane.
Jakie są trzy najpopularniejsze modele cloud computingu?
Istnieją trzy najpopularniejsze modele chmury obliczeniowej:
- Oprogramowanie jako usługa (SaaS): Aplikacje oprogramowania są hostowane i zarządzane przez dostawcę chmury i można uzyskać do nich dostęp za pośrednictwem przeglądarki internetowej bez konieczności instalacji. Przykłady aplikacji do miejsca pracy to Google Workspace z Gmailem, Salesforce i Dropbox. Jest to najpopularniejszy model dla użytkowników indywidualnych, ponieważ ucieleśnia naturę większości wzorców połączeń.
- Platforma jako usługa (PaaS): Są to platformy, na których użytkownicy mogą tworzyć, iterować i uruchamiać aplikacje. Przykłady: AWS Elastic Beanstalk dla Amazon i Microsoft Azure.
- Infrastruktura jako usługa (IaaS): Dostarcza usługi takie jak komputery, serwery, magazyny i sieci, które tworzą i uruchamiają Twoje własne programy i systemy operacyjne. Przykłady: Amaz Á Amazon ÉC2, Google Compute Engine.
Jaka jest główna różnica między cloud computing a SaaS?
Cloud computing to uogólniony termin opisujący liczne modele świadczenia usług, z których jednym jest SaaS. Cloud computing można najlepiej zdefiniować jako całą pizzę, a SaaS można postrzegać jako jeden kawałek pizzy, a konkretnie kawałek aplikacji programowej, w którym dostawca usługi zapewnia wszystkie inne składniki, takie jak serwery, pamięć masowa itp.
Jakie są korzyści z cloud computing dla firm?
- Oszczędności kosztów: Gdy koszty operacyjne są zmniejszone, trzeba zapłacić za wykorzystane zasoby.
- Skalowalność i elastyczność: Możliwość zwiększania lub zmniejszania zidentyfikowanych zasobów w zależności od potrzeby wyeliminowania przekroczeń kosztów lub nieefektywności w wykorzystaniu.
- Niezawodność i dostępność: Można to zaobserwować u dostawców chmury z rozbudowaną infrastrukturą, zapewniającą dostępność usług i systemy odzyskiwania po awarii.
- Współpraca i dostępność: Interakcja i łatwy dostęp do informacji z dowolnej lokalizacji w celu usprawnienia.
- Automatyczne aktualizacje oprogramowania: Chmura obliczeniowa kontroluje ręczne aktualizacje i zadania konserwacyjne z zasobów IT na inne działania.
Jakie są kwestie bezpieczeństwa związane z cloud computing?
Należy zauważyć, że bezpieczeństwo jest wynikiem współpracy między Tobą a dostawcą chmury. Oto kluczowe kwestie:
- Bezpieczeństwo danych i prywatność: Wybierz dostawcę, którego bezpieczeństwo jest najwyższej klasy i który posiada odpowiednie funkcje, takie jak szyfrowanie i kontrola dostępu do obsługi Twoich danych.
- to proces ciągły.: Upewnij się, że dostawca przestrzega standardowych zasad i przepisów, szczególnie jeśli Twoja firma zajmuje się danymi wrażliwymi (na przykład w sektorze opieki zdrowotnej i finansowym).
- Reagowanie na incydenty: W szczególności dowiedz się, jakie środki dostawca wdrożył w celu reagowania na wszelkie incydenty i w jaki sposób poinformuje Cię o takim zdarzeniu.
- Model współodpowiedzialności: Pamiętaj, że ochrona danych i aplikacji jest Twoją odpowiedzialnością, podczas gdy dostawca odpowiada za bezpieczeństwo infrastruktury.
Jeśli potrzebujesz dostawcy chmury, oto kilka z wielu dostępnych opcji Amazon Web Services (AWS), Microsoft Azure, i Platforma Google Cloud (GCP).
Wniosek
Cloud computing można zdefiniować jako narzędzie dla każdej organizacji dowolnej wielkości i typu do zarządzania danymi wejściowymi lub kontrolowania wydatków w procesie dostawy. Jednak przed przejściem do chmury warto wziąć pod uwagę różne czynniki dotyczące dokładnych potrzeb, kosztów i bezpieczeństwa.